Warren tennis sweeps Crossett in ranked matches

Bayleigh Miller in action for Warren.

WARREN, Ark. – The Warren High School tennis team put together a strong performance on the road Tuesday, defeating Crossett and winning every ranked match.

Presley Reep won her singles match 6-0, while Bayleigh Miller claimed a 6-3 victory. In doubles play, the pair of Anna Arroyo and Ava Denton earned a dominant 6-0 win, and teammates Livi McKinney and Avery Wharton followed suit with a 6-0 result. McKinney also added a 6-0 singles win to cap off the night.

Head coach Micah Richey said the team also secured several exhibition wins in addition to their ranked success.

The Saline River Player of the Match was awarded to freshman Bayleigh Miller. Coach Richey noted that Miller faced a skilled Crossett opponent and excelled at finishing points quickly rather than letting rallies drag on. He also praised her dedication, highlighting the extra work she puts in daily to improve her game.

“Her hard work does not go unnoticed,” Richey said. “Good job Bayleigh!”
